Kieren McGarry
3×3 · top 8.5% of 284,439 all-time · competing since May 2022 · 2022MCGA01
Kieren McGarry has been competing for 4 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 10.36, set at Cape Cod 2023, puts him in the top 8.5%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 4,692nd in the United States. Until February 2007, no official 3×3 solve in the world had been that fast. Across 8 competitions since May 2022, he has put 254 official solves on the record across nine events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 11% around a typical one, steadier than 89%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ds. His 3×3 best has come down from 15.85 in May 2022 to 10.36, a 35% improvement. Kieren has entered eight competitions, more competitions than 90%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
